Tubo boot blew off
Turbo boot blew off on my way to Terra Haute In and blew oil all over the engine this weekend now the truck does not want to start have cam pos error, ICP error pulling my hair out any ideas.

Did you reattach the boot? The oil is just from the crankcase vent, since it vents into the intake right in front of the turbo, not a big deal. Clean the boot up really well and reinstall, it should be fine.
The cam position sensor is probably just being falsely thrown from trying to crank it. Why did the truck shut off? We need a lot more info here about how this went down. Did the truck shut off or did you shut it off and then it wouldn't restart? The boot blowing off would have nothing to do with the ICP, chances are you had other issues going on and the boot blowing off is completely separate.
